As I'm sure most of you have picked up on, I'm trying to highlight how fragmented our focus has become as a society because of the constant stimulation that we're bombarded with the second we wake up in the morning.
I mean, how many of us (myself included) check their phone immediately upon waking?
We have constant notifications popping up on all our devices.
There are near endless TV channels and streaming services.
Videos games, social media, news feeds, etc. etc.
It's turned us into a society that has lost patience and focus.
We have to be entertained at all times with things that require very short bursts of focus and attention.
